About the Role
At Flow, hospitality is at the heart of everything we do. Our Servers / Bartenders are more than service professionals, they’re experience creators, community builders, and brand ambassadors who bring warmth, energy, and intention to every interaction. You’ll collaborate closely with management to deliver seasonal menus, uphold elevated service standards, and foster a culture rooted in teamwork, respect, and strong morale. The ideal candidate crafts quality beverages while creating a welcoming, engaging atmosphere for Flow’s wellness-focused community.
Responsibilities- Deliver genuine, high-quality service that makes residents and guests feel welcomed and cared for
- Prepare and serve cocktails, beer, wine, and café offerings with speed, consistency, and attention to quality
- Build rapport with residents and guests and contribute to a vibrant social atmosphere
- Operate efficiently in a fast-paced environment while balancing multiple priorities
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of the bar, service areas, and shared spaces
- Support events, activations, and community programming as needed
- Collaborate with café, kitchen, and operations teams to ensure smooth service
- Uphold Flow’s standards for hospitality, safety, and responsible service
- Lift, carry, push, pull, and place objects weighing up to 50 pounds as needed
- Actively engage guests and promote Flow merchandise with knowledge and enthusiasm
- Minimum of 2 years of server and/or bartender experience in a hospitality-driven environment
- Experience in an bar, restaurant, café, or hospitality concept with an emphasis on quality, consistency, and guest experience
- Experience supporting new openings, evolving concepts, or fast-growing environments strongly preferred
- Strong communication skills and the ability to connect naturally with guests and teammates
- Comfortable operating in dynamic, fast-paced environments and wearing multiple hats as needed
- Valid Food Handler’s Certificate (preferred)
